v3.25.4
Balance Sheet Details - Schedule of Other Current Liabilities (Details) - USD ($)
$ in Millions
Dec. 31, 2025
Dec. 31, 2024
Organization, Consolidation and Presentation of Financial Statements [Abstract]    
Accrued compensation $ 62 $ 61
Other accrued expenses 38 28
Total other current liabilities $ 100 $ 89